Output 51c587f72a893e9e148384d41f175297ea6a4de73431721d7171ed89940fec2a:0

value
1640039
script pubkey
OP_0 OP_PUSHBYTES_20 fddebff2491fe4a2bfcc68294c4b9b3bed818608
address
bc1qlh0tlujfrlj2907vdq55cjum80kcrpsg8detpp
transaction
51c587f72a893e9e148384d41f175297ea6a4de73431721d7171ed89940fec2a
spent
true